Pride Veterinary Referrals is a large, purpose-built, state-of-the-art referral hospital in Derby. The facilities include thirteen consultation rooms, seven hospital wards including a dedicated ICU ward, five theatres, two ultrasound rooms, a cardiology suite, an advanced imaging suite with CT and MRI, interventional radiology capability, an endoscopy suite, hydrotherapy pool and treadmills, and a dedicated chemotherapy room. Altogether, we encompass a team of more than 50 Referral veterinary professionals, delivering specialist-led services across all disciplines. Our aim is to deliver world-class patient care, with collaboration across all services to provide the best possible outcome for all patients. Working alongside our referral practice, we also have a first opinion service and Vets at Night out-of-hours team and work closely with Nottingham University providing rotations for veterinary students.
